[Code of Federal Regulations] [Title 21, Volume 8] [Revised as of April 1, 2008] From the U.S. Government Printing Office via GPO Access [CITE: 21CFR1250.25] [Page 704] TITLE 21--FOOD AND DRUGS CHAPTER I--FOOD AND DRUG ADMINISTRATION, DEPARTMENT OF HEALTH AND HUMAN SERVICES (CONTINUED) PART 1250_INTERSTATE CONVEYANCE SANITATION--Table of Contents Subpart B_Food Service Sanitation on Land and Air Conveyances, and Vessels Sec. 1250.25 Source identification and inspection of food and drink. (a) Operators of conveyances shall identify, when requested by the Commissioner of Food and Drugs, the vendors, distributors or dealers from whom they have acquired or are acquiring their food supply, including milk, fluid milk products, ice cream and other frozen desserts, butter, cheese, bottled water, sandwiches and box lunches. (b) The Commissioner of Food and Drugs may inspect any source of such food supply in order to determine whether the requirements of the regulations in this subpart and in Sec. 1240.20 of this chapter are being met, and may utilize the results of inspections of such sources made by representatives of State health departments or of the health authorities of contiguous foreign nations.
